Overview of the role
The Inventory Controller fully follows operating procedures, and provides inventory control service, ensuring that the stocks are available when needed and that stock movement is accurately tracked and maintained through the entire process and stock loss risks are minimized.
What you will do
Tracking shipments
- Controlling the product's inputs & outputs from warehouses/ Other Stores. Stock discrepancy during receiving must be escalated to the supplier/sender by raising an SRD report.
- Coordinate until the SRDs are adjusted in the system. Tracking & updating stocks both on Incoming/Outgoing Log Books & in the system.
Stock Accuracy Checks
- Avoiding product shortages by investigating on a weekly basis. Perform investigations based on Stock Accuracy Checks
- Segregation of Damages in the stock room. Ensuring the movement of the damaged units/ Uniforms to SOF.
Support to the events
- Prepare the store for marketing events (if any), and arrange for stock count procedures (additional cartons and segregating stocks for easy scanning/counting purposes).
Missing Barcodes
- Must accurately record the quality, quantity, type, style, and other inventory characteristics so the store team clearly understands what is and isn’t available in case the barcode is unidentifiable.
- This needs to be sent to the brand team in Dubai for further assistance with the barcode. All such merchandise is to be separately put up in the stock room with the updated information in the form of report to the OPM on a monthly basis.
Physical presence during maintenance work
- Presence during any maintenance-related work activity in the store (Often the night after the store closing).
Budgeting and Finance
- Must be involved in the annual business planning and manage monthly budgets.
- Will create PO, track invoices, and ensure the work is completed with the allocated SLA and invoiced by the Service Provider (if required).
Asset Management
- Have to manage all the non-merchandise assets stored inside stock rooms for business-related activity purposes.
